Starting with Lumenfold 3.2, the consent banner ships enabled on all tenant sites, and plugins that inject scripts before consent is granted will be blocked at render time. Register your scripts through the `consentGate` hook instead of writing directly to the page head. The gate categories (essential, analytics, marketing) map to banner toggles, so choose accurately — miscategorized scripts fail the rollout audit. Before testing, apply the following configuration values to your staging tenant.

service settings:
[zorath]
host = zorath.qirvanlabs.internal
user = zorath_svc
database = zorath_prod

## GraphWeave renders an empty canvas

If GraphWeave shows a blank pane after loading a lockfile, it's almost always the resolver cache going stale. Clear `~/.graphweave/cache` and re-run `weave render --force`. Still blank? Check that the Spindle API is reachable — the visualizer silently drops nodes when the metadata fetch 401s. Yes, silently. We know, it's on the backlog. To test the metadata endpoint manually, hit `/v2/nodes` with curl and pass the service token as the bearer credential below.

session JWT of yawep-yawep = eyJhbGciOiJIUzI1NiIsInR5cCI6IkpXVCJ9.eyJzdWIiOiI3pWF3_In0.aXYsHiog

14:32 — Refactor of the legacy Quillbark ORM layer merged to staging. We replaced the hand-rolled session pooling in `orm/core.py` with the new Lattice adapter, preserving lazy-load semantics for the Invoice and Ledger models. Regression suite passed on the second run after we pinned the fixture ordering; the first failure was nondeterministic teardown, not the refactor itself. Query counts dropped roughly 18% on the checkout path. The staging build that contains these changes is identified below.

pipeline stamp: htk31_f769b577b3028a4e9958e5bb8d1259a

**Ticket: Config drift on proctoring queue workers**

Heads up — the Veridex exam-proctoring queue workers in the east cluster drifted from what's in the repo again. Candidates are seeing longer check-in waits because the concurrency caps don't match. Probably someone hot-patched during last week's exam window and never committed. Before we reconcile, here's what's actually running on the boxes right now.

settings of tagef-bawif:
DRUIX_HOST=druix.zemvarlabs.internal
DRUIX_PORT=8000